Application of the Naïve Bayesian Classifier to optimize treatment decisions

Summary
The Naïve Bayesian Classifier (NBC) accurately predicts cancer relapse risk in brain tumor patients after radiotherapy (RT). This tool aids in assessing individual patient outcomes for improved treatment strategies.
Area of Science:
- Oncology
- Medical Informatics
- Machine Learning
Background:
- Radiotherapy (RT) is a common treatment for brain tumors.
- Accurate prediction of cancer relapse or progression is crucial for patient management.
- Existing methods for risk assessment may benefit from advanced computational tools.
Purpose of the Study:
- To evaluate the accuracy, specificity, and sensitivity of the Naïve Bayesian Classifier (NBC) for predicting individual cancer relapse risk.
- To assess the utility of NBC in patients undergoing postoperative radiotherapy for brain tumors.
Main Methods:
- Analysis of data from 142 brain tumor patients treated with RT (2000-2005).
- Utilized 96 binary attributes related to disease, patient, and treatment for NBC model training.
- Validated classifier performance using leave-one-out and cross-validation, and a clinical test with 35 patients.
Main Results:
- Achieved high classification accuracy (84%), specificity (0.87), and sensitivity (0.80).
- NBC demonstrated consistent performance in both training and clinical evaluation phases.
- The classifier effectively calculated individual probabilities for relapse or progression.
Conclusions:
- The Naïve Bayesian Classifier (NBC) is a valuable tool for supporting risk assessment in brain tumor patients post-radiotherapy.
- NBC can aid clinicians in identifying patients at higher risk of relapse or progression.
- This predictive capability can inform personalized treatment decisions and improve patient outcomes.
